There is not a direct bus from Topeka, KS to Fort Kent, ME.

There is a bus stop in Topeka, KS, but not one in Fort Kent, ME. The closest bus stop from Fort Kent, ME is in Bangor, ME, which is around 167 miles away.

There may be a bus schedule from Topeka, KS to Bangor, ME.

The population of Topeka, KS is 125,819

Topeka, KS is in Shawnee county.

The population of Fort Kent, ME is 3,852

Fort Kent, ME is in Aroostook county.
